Subject: Tidelight widget — handover

Hi, and welcome aboard! Quick note before you dig into the Tidelight tide-table widget: the old maintainer moved to the Harborview mapping team, so responsibilities have shifted. You'll handle styling and data-refresh bugs; anything touching the prediction model goes upstream. Docs are in the Tidelight wiki, and the test harness is a bit crusty but works. Your new point of contact for all Tidelight matters is below.

named custodian: Brivan Eliath Quenox Frador

Subject: Marketing Budget Reduction — Q3

Team,

Following last week's review, the executive team has approved a 12% reduction to the marketing budget for the remainder of the year. The cut falls mainly on the Brightfen campaign and sponsorship of the Orlace trade fair. Finance should reallocate the freed funds to the contingency line and update the forecast by Friday. Our rationale relates to a planned shift we are not yet announcing publicly.

management briefing: The southern region missed its Wenvan quota by 3.5 percent last quarter. Ralysek Holdings plans to lower the Fraox list price by 41.2 percent in November. The pricing group signed off on a budget of $176.6 million for Project Tamael. The renewal with Wenvanix Systems closes at $320.5 million a year, 62.6 percent below the last contract.

Management Meeting Minutes — Prepared for Incoming Director

Attendees: Pell, Varga, Osmund. Topic: customer concentration. Quillbrook Fabrication now represents 41% of revenue, up from 28% last year. Risks noted: contract renewal in March, pricing leverage, single-site dependency. Actions: Varga to model loss scenarios; Pell to accelerate mid-market pipeline. Review set for next month. Strategic response is outlined in the confidential note below.

confidential, yahip-hagug: Gorixax Logistics plans to lower the Ulaael list price by 26.6 percent in October. The pricing group signed off on a budget of $199.9 million for Project Holix. The renewal with Kasdorox Systems closes at $137.5 million a year, 8.2 percent above the last contract. Project Lamion slips by a full year because of the audit delay.